Hawks-Heat game thread

Greetings, all-

Hope all are well. Ken here. A few notes, some Mike Bibby quotes and we’ll get it rolling.

1) Larry Drew said it’ll be the big lineup. Jason Collins, Al Horford, Josh Smith, Joe Johnson, Kirk Hinrich.

2) Drew didn’t say he was committed to starting Jeff Teague with the “regular” lineup. He said it was still to be determined. It sounded like Teague would be the designated starter against teams with small, quick point guards.

3) Drew said he wants the team to be more committed to running, particularly after the rather sedentary effort against Denver. Other keys: defending the 3-point line, not letting the non-Bosh/James/Wade guys go off, rebound well, force Miami to defend.

4) Drew on Horford: “We definitely have to get him more shot attempts, we’ve got to get him more touches and we’ll try to get him back on track tonight.”

5) Some Bibby quotes:

On buying out his Washington contract: “It is (a risk), but you never know if there’s going to be a lockout or not. There’s a lot of talk about that. I just felt that being here would be a better situation for me as far as giving myself another chance to even get another contract. I just felt it was a better decision for me to be here.”

On the trade:  “This is a business. They felt they needed to change the point guard position and that’s what they did. Somebody’s trash is somebody else’s treasure.”

On coming off the bench: “I don’t mind that. I like to win games regardless of how things go down. I don’t worry myself with points, shots, stuff like that. I just do whatever it takes to help win the game.”
